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Amazon Black Howler | Fanged River Frog |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Animals)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um same | Chordata (cordados) | Chordata (cordados) |
| Class | Mammalia (mamíferos) | Amphibia (Amphibians) |
| Order | Primates (Primates) | Anura (Frogs & Toads) |
| Family | Atelidae | Dicroglossidae |
| Genus | Alouatta | Limnonectes |
| Species | Alouatta nigerrima | Limnonectes macrodon |
Evolutionary Relationship
Amazon Black Howler and Fanged River Frog share a common ancestor at the Phylum level: Chordata. (cordados)
